Analysis

In 2024, number of refugees per 100000 in Marshall Islands stood at 0. That is the lowest value across all 11 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 100.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, number of refugees per 100000 in Marshall Islands peaked at 16.91 in 2021 and was at its lowest, 0, in 2023.

That places Marshall Islands 196th out of 204 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
